Output f21587e21a542b053c31af9d9f82b471de21c821d874c927aebbf583bbe8d314:2

value
271332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c444250e177bb05b8ba292421c0c227e2d1202 OP_EQUAL
address
32DWRKLFnzQrK4bSfdABP9skRq9kGga8re
transaction
f21587e21a542b053c31af9d9f82b471de21c821d874c927aebbf583bbe8d314
spent
true